Fagerström Test for Nicotine Dependence
The Fagerström Test for Nicotine Dependence (FTND) is a brief, validated self-report instrument originally developed by Fagerstrom in 1978 and revised by Heatherton and colleagues in 1991 to quantify the severity of nicotine dependence in cigarette smokers. The FTND comprises six items assessing morning cigarette use, daily cigarette consumption, and the subjective difficulty of abstaining from smoking. It is the most widely used measure of nicotine dependence in smoking cessation research and clinical practice.
